Historically, the wellness industry and the body positivity movement were at odds. Marketing campaigns frequently used "wellness" as a euphemism for weight loss. Detox diets, intense exercise regimes, and supplement trends were often sold using shame and fear tactics.

Self-acceptance does not mean ignoring your health; it means caring for your body because you value it, not because you hate it. Motivation rooted in self-love lasts much longer than motivation rooted in self-loathing. How to Cultivate a Body-Positive Wellness Routine

A related concept that focuses on what the body does rather than what it looks like. It provides a middle ground for those who find it difficult to constantly "love" their appearance, emphasizing respect for bodily functions like breathing, moving, and resting.

: Instead of obsessing over appearance, appreciate your body for what it can do—like hiking a mountain, learning an instrument, or simply providing the energy to connect with others.

: If "loving" your body feels out of reach, aim for neutrality. This means recognizing your body as a vessel that deserves care regardless of its size.

Research into the paradigm shows that focusing on health behaviors—like eating a variety of nutrient-dense foods, managing stress, getting enough sleep, and staying active—improves metabolic health markers (such as blood pressure and blood sugar levels) completely independent of weight loss. Conversely, chronic weight cycling (yo-yo dieting) and the chronic stress caused by weight stigma are documented contributors to systemic inflammation and poor health outcomes.
